Pricing Your Air Travel

The Dallas Morning News gives us the run down of the different charges Airlines make these due to their increasing costs:


Airlines are adding fees and charges aggressively as they grapple with rising fuel costs.

AMERICAN AIRLINES

$5 to redeem a frequent-flier award online, up from $0

$6 for a sandwich or liquor,

up from $5

$15 to check the first bag (each way), up from $0

DELTA AIR LINES

$25 for booking a trip over the phone, up from $20

$100 for an unaccompanied minor on nonstop flights, up from $50

$100 for transporting a pet in the cabin, up from $75

UNITED AIRLINES

$25 to check a second bag (each way), up from $0

$150 to change a nonrefundable ticket, up from $100

OTHER AIRLINES

US Airways: $5 and up for a window or aisle seat in the first rows of coach, up from $0

Northwest: $50 for each bag weighing over 50 pounds, up from $25

Frontier: $100 to transport antlers, up from $75

SOURCES: The airlines; Dallas Morning News research
